Whiting refuses request for grid practice starts

The FIA's technical delegate Charlie Whiting has refused a request from several drivers during their meeting on Thursday in which they asked for permission to practice their starts on the grid. The reason for the request stems from changes to the grid which sees the first 11 slots featuring 'drainage grooves' which was highlighted by several drivers during Thursday's track walk. Positions 12 to 22 don't feature the grooves and therefore may be at a disadvantage should it rain on Sunday, or an advantage should it remain dry, as the contact patch is greater allowing for better grip.
